首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何使用matplotlib显示Python Crash课程第15章直方图

要使用matplotlib显示Python Crash课程第15章的直方图,可以按照以下步骤进行操作:

  1. 导入所需的库和模块:
代码语言:txt
复制
import matplotlib.pyplot as plt
import numpy as np
  1. 创建数据集:
代码语言:txt
复制
data = np.random.randn(1000)  # 生成1000个随机数作为数据集
  1. 绘制直方图:
代码语言:txt
复制
plt.hist(data, bins=30, color='skyblue', edgecolor='black')  # 设置直方图的颜色和边界颜色
  1. 添加标题和标签:
代码语言:txt
复制
plt.title('Histogram of Python Crash Course Chapter 15')  # 添加标题
plt.xlabel('Value')  # 添加x轴标签
plt.ylabel('Frequency')  # 添加y轴标签
  1. 显示图形:
代码语言:txt
复制
plt.show()

这样就可以使用matplotlib显示Python Crash课程第15章的直方图了。

关于matplotlib的更多信息和使用方法,可以参考腾讯云的相关产品Matplotlib介绍页面:Matplotlib产品介绍

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

谷歌上线机器学习速成课程:中文配音+中文字幕+完全免费!

课程地址: https://developers.google.com/machine-learning/crash-course/?...您应该了解变量和系数、线性方程式、函数图和直方图(熟悉对数和导数等更高级的数学概念会有帮助,但不是必需条件)。 熟练掌握编程基础知识,并且具有一些使用 Python 进行编码的经验。...机器学习速成课程中的编程练习是通过 TensorFlow 并使用 Python 进行编码的。...Pandas 使用入门 机器学习速成课程中的编程练习使用 Pandas 库来操控数据集。...Python 教程还介绍了以下更高级的 Python 功能: 列表推导式 Lambda 函数 第三方 Python 库 机器学习速成课程代码示例使用了第三方库提供的以下功能。

1.9K90

Python 可视化视频课 - 4. Seaborn 中

Python 数据可视化 MatplotlibMatplotlib 下 Seaborn 上 之前 Python 数据分析和基础系列的所有课程链接如下。...函数上:低阶函数 函数下:高阶函数 类和对象:封装-继承-多态-组合 字符串专场:格式化和正则化 解析表达式:简约也简单 生成器和迭代器:简约不简单 装饰器:高端不简单 Seaborn 中关注的内容是...组合图 多图网格 配对网格 联合网格 统计分析就是去理解一个数据集中变量之间的关系,以及这些关系如何受到其他变量的影响。Seaborn 的主要用处就是可视化这个过程。...分布图 (distributional plot) 显示定量变量的分布 分类图 (categorical plot) 显示定量变量在分类变量下每个类别的分布 回归图 (regression plot)...关系图 散点图 线形图 分布图 直方图 KDE 图 ECDF 图 地毯图 分类图 条纹图 蜂群图 箱型图 提琴图 条形图 计数图 点图 回归图 回归图 残差图 矩阵图 热力图

1.1K10
  • 谷歌发布基于TensorFlow机器学习速成课程(中文)

    先附上课程地址:https://developers.google.cn/machine-learning/crash-course/ 本课程解答的问题清单 机器学习与传统编程有何不同?...什么是损失,如何衡量损失? 梯度下降法的运作方式是怎样的? 如何确定我的模型是否有效? 怎样为机器学习提供我的数据? 如何构建深度神经网络?...前提条件 学习本课程之前,官方建议最好满足以下两点条件: 掌握入门级代数知识。 您应该了解变量和系数、线性方程式、函数图和直方图(熟悉对数和导数等更高级的数学概念会有帮助,但不是必需条件)。...熟练掌握编程基础知识,并且具有一些使用 Python 进行编码的经验。 机器学习速成课程中的编程练习是通过 TensorFlow 并使用 Python 进行编码的。...您无需拥有使用 TensorFlow 的任何经验,但应该能够熟练阅读和编写包含基础编程结构(例如,函数定义/调用、列表和字典、循环和条件表达式)的 Python 代码。

    76690

    Python机器学习·微教程

    不要被这些吓到了,并非要求你是个机器学习专家,只是你要知道如何查找并学习使用。 所以这个教程既不是python入门,也不是机器学习入门。...教程目录 该教程分为12节 1节:下载并安装python及Scipy生态 2节:熟悉使用python、numpy、matplotlib和pandas 3节:加载CSV数据 4节:对数据进行描述性统计分析...2节:熟悉使用python、numpy、matplotlib和pandas 第一步,你要能够读写python脚本。 python是一门区分大小写、使用#注释、用tab缩进表示代码块的语言。...这一小节目的在于练习python语法,以及在python环境下如何使用重要的Scipy生态工具。...matplotlib绘制简单图表 plt.show() # 显示图像 3节:加载CSV数据 机器学习算法需要有数据,这节讲解如何python中正确地加载CSV数据集 有几种常用的方法供参考: 使用标准库中

    1.4K20

    用Pandas在Python中可视化机器学习数据

    更了解您的数据的最快方法是使用数据可视化。 在这篇文章中,您将会发现如何使用Pandas在Python中可视化您的机器学习数据。 让我们开始吧。...单变量直方图 密度图 密度图是快速了解每个属性分布情况的另一种方法。这些图像看起来像是一个抽象的直方图,在每个数据箱的顶部绘制了一条平滑的曲线,就像您的眼睛如何理解直方图一样。...多变量图 本部分显示多个变量之间交互的图表示例。 相关矩阵图 相关性表明两个变量之间的变化是如何相关的。如果两个变量在同一个方向上变化,它们是正相关的。...由于每个变量的散点图都没有绘制点,所以对角线显示了每个属性的直方图。 概要 在这篇文章中,您发现了许多方法,可以使用Pandas更好地理解Python中的机器学习数据。...具体来说,你学会了如何使用如下方法来绘制你的数据: 直方图 密度图 盒和晶须图 相关矩阵图 散点图矩阵

    2.8K60

    只有Python基础竟成为无人驾驶工程师,她是怎么做到的?

    这门课程将帮助你从基本的编程经验和数学基础起步,学习使用 Python 和 C++ 解决相关问题,掌握开发无人驾驶车所需的核心技能,带领你了解最精彩的自动化系统工程领域!...你如何正式确定这样一台电脑可以开汽车?试想一下,你将控制汽车完成直行、转弯和侧方停车等高难度动作!太不可思议了! 实战项目2 完成矩阵类 在此项目中,你将用 Python 完成矩阵类。...实战项目3 将 Python 翻译成 C++ 在此项目中,你需要将第一节课的直方图过滤器代码翻译成更快的 C++,以巩固你对 C++ 语法的了解。 ?...实战项目6 利用 Matplotlib 构建可重用的数据可视化程序 MatplotlibPython 最热门的数据可视化库之一。...你需要利用 Matplotlib 构建可重用的数据可视化工具,以便帮助你理解你一直使用的离散和连续轨迹。

    1.4K50

    Python语言和matplotlib库做数据可视化分析

    以下文章来源于数据思践 ,作者王路情 这是我的51篇原创文章,关于数据可视化分析。 阅读完本文,你可以知道: 1 Python语言的可视化库—matplotlib?...2 使用matplotlib实现常用的可视化?...1 matplotlibmatplotlib库是Python语言最流行和基础的数据可视化库,是一个二维图形库。它是Python社区中广泛使用的绘图库,已经有数十年的历史了。...它是一个非常通用的可视化库,只需要几行代码,就可以生成柱状图、直方图、功率谱图、散点图、误差图、饼图和许多其他类型的图。关于matplotlib的详细介绍和学习,可以查阅它的官方网址。...库所需的函数集 import matplotlib.pyplot as plt 0.2 绘图的模板,显示和保存 代码片段 # 绘图的通用格式 plt.plot(...) # 绘图结果的显示 plt.show

    77710

    用Pandas在Python中可视化机器学习数据

    使用数据可视化可以更快的帮助你对数据有更深入的了解。 在这篇文章中,您将会发现如何Python使用Pandas来可视化您的机器学习数据。 让我们开始吧。...[Visualize-Machine-Learning-Data-in-Python-With-Pandas.jpg] 关于样本 本文中的每个样本都是完整且独立的,因此您可以直接将其复制到您自己的项目中使用...由于对角线上的散点图都是由每一个变量自己绘制出的小点,所以对角线显示了每个特征的直方图。...[Scatterplot-Matrix.png] 概要 在这篇文章中,您学会了许多在Python使用Pandas来可视化您的机器学习数据的方法。...具体来说,也就是如何绘制你的数据图: 直方图 密度图 箱线图 相关矩阵图 散点图矩阵

    6.1K50

    谷歌上线自带中文的机器学习免费课程,我们带你做了个测评

    那么对于初学者,到底如何选择最新入手的课程呢?...如何确定我的模型是否有效? 怎样为机器学习提供我的数据? 如何构建深度神经网络? 谷歌建议学习者掌握入门级代数,熟练掌握编程基础知识和Python。...你应该了解变量和系数、线性方程式、函数图和直方图(熟悉对数和导数等更高级的数学概念会有帮助,但不是必需条件); 熟练掌握编程基础知识,并且具有一些使用Python进行编程的经验。...机器学习速成课程中的编程练习是通过TensorFlow并使用Python进行编码的。...你无需拥有使用TensorFlow 的经验,但应该能够熟练阅读和编写包含基础编程结构(例如,函数定义/调用、列表和字典、循环和条件表达式)的Python代码。

    69450

    万字长文告诉新手如何学习Python图像处理(上篇完结 四十四) | 「Python」有奖征文

    算子、Canny算子和LOG算子 [Python图像处理] 三十七.OpenCV和Matplotlib绘制直方图万字详解(掩膜直方图、H-S直方图、黑夜白天判断) [Python图像处理] 三十八....经典示例: (1) 显示多张图像 在OpenCV中,主要调用Matplotlib绘制显示多张图形,从而方便实验对比,如下代码所示。...1.Python直方图统计 推荐文章: [Python图像处理] 三十七.OpenCV直方图统计两万字详解(掩膜直方图、灰度直方图对比、黑夜白天预测) 核心内容: 图像直方图概述 Matplotlib绘制直方图...类)、沙滩(1类)、建筑(2类)、大卡车(3类)、恐龙(4类)、大象(5类)、花朵(6类)、马(7类)、山峰(8类)和食品(9类),每类100张。...代码中对预测集的前十张图像进行了显示,其中“368.jpg”图像如图所示,其分类预测的类标结果为“3”,表示3类大卡车,预测结果正确。

    2K11

    opencv(4.5.3)-python(二十五)--二维直方图

    翻译及二次校对:cvtutorials.com 目标 在本章中,我们将学习如何寻找和绘制二维直方图。它对后面的章节会有帮助。 绪论 在第一篇文章中,我们计算并绘制了一维直方图。...已经有一个python样本(samples/python/color_histogram.py)用于寻找颜色直方图。我们将尝试理解如何创建这样的颜色直方图,这对理解直方图反投影等进一步的主题很有用。...现在我们可以检查如何绘制这个颜色直方图。 绘制二维直方图 方法-1:使用cv.imshow() 我们得到的结果是一个大小为180x256的二维数组。...方法-2:使用Matplotlib 我们可以使用matplotlib.pyplot.imshow()函数来绘制带有不同颜色图谱的2D直方图。这可以让我们更好地了解不同的像素密度。...方法3:OpenCV的样本风格 在OpenCV-Python2样本(samples/python/color_histogram.py)中,有一个颜色直方图的示例代码。

    53430

    十七.可视化分析之Matplotlib、Pandas、Echarts入门万字详解

    如果读者想仅仅获取某一个城市的房价,比如“贵阳”,再绘制成折线图,如何实现呢?...下图显示ECharts官网示例,推荐大家从官网进行学习,它提供了详细的实例及使用文档。...Python通过调用可视化分析库实现图形绘制,以直观的形式反映数据的特点或结果的好坏,常用的扩展包包括Matplotlib、Pandas、Seaborn等,同时如果您使用Python开发网站,建议读者可以结合...[Python数据挖掘课程] 六.Numpy、Pandas和Matplotlib包基础知识[EB/OL] . (2016-11-17)[2017-11-15]. http://blog.csdn.net...[python数据挖掘课程] 十.Pandas、Matplotlib、PCA绘图实用代码补充[EB/OL]. (2017-03-07)[2017-11-18]. http://blog.csdn.net

    2.5K30

    利用Python进行描述统计

    比如,在某次考试中,某位考生取得了70分,他的成绩如何并不容易知道,但是如果知道70分对应的是90百分位数,我们就能知道大约90%的学生的考分比他低,而约10%的学生考分比他高。...如何计算p百分位数? Step1:将所有观测值从小到大排列。 Step2:计算i = (p/100)n p是所求的百分位数的位置,n是项数。...利用Python进行统计描述 绘图法:MatplotlibPython绘制条形图 # 导入需要用到的库 import numpy as np import pandas as pd import matplotlib.pyplot...) plt.show() 用Python绘制直方图 # 数据准备 a = np.random.randn(100) # 从标准正态分布中随机抽取了100个数值 s = pd.Series(a)...# 用 Matplotlib直方图 plt.hist(s) plt.show() 用Python绘制箱线图 # 数据准备 data = np.random.normal(size=(10,4))

    2.7K30
    领券